Best advice, don't panic

I think every parent goes through this, and with the advent of the internet it's getting worse.

If your kid is sick, be careful in overreacting.

Recently, our daughter was kind of ill. She had a fairly severe fever, was a little lethargic, and actually threw up for the first time in her life (she was 20 months old).

We panicked, and remembered how the day before, we found a tick in her room. Surely, she had contracted lyme disease. She had the symptoms, and certainly there had to be a connection.

Well...come to find out, that it takes a tick like 6 hours to give you anything at all, and there wasn't even a tick on her body. Bad diagnosis, Dad!

Turns out, she was more likely a little dehydrated and exausted, because she was bright and chipper a day later.

And turns out...the vomit was only because we took her on her first plane ride. Oops!

So rather than run to the internet and decide that your baby's hacking cough can certainly only be mesothelioma, or that her skin rash must certainly be ebola...just think calmly and realize it's either a bad cold or Roseola.
